访问
linux下mysql开启远程访问权限防火墙开放3306端口
linux下mysql开启远程访问权限防⽕墙开放3306端⼝开启mysql的远程访问权限默认mysql的⽤户是没有远程访问的权限的,因此当程序跟数据库不在同⼀台服务器上时,我们需要开启mysql的远程访问权限。主流的有两种⽅法,改表法和授权法。mysql默认端口相对⽽⾔,改表法⽐较容易⼀点,个⼈也是⽐较倾向于使⽤这种⽅法,因此,这⾥只贴出改表法1、登陆mysqlmysql -u root -p2、...
MySQL数据库远程访问安全配置指南
MySQL数据库远程访问安全配置指南引言:MySQL是当前最流行的关系型数据库管理系统之一,广泛应用于各种规模的企业和个人项目中。远程访问MySQL数据库可以提供更加灵活的数据管理和共享,然而同时也带来了一些潜在的安全风险。为了保障数据库的安全性,本文将提供一些MySQL远程访问安全配置的指南,帮助用户在使用MySQL数据库时避免潜在的安全威胁。一、配置防火墙规则防火墙是保障服务器安全的第一道防线...
jsonobject的getinnermap方法
JSON 对象中的 getInnerMap 方法 JSON 对象是一种用于存储和传输数据的格式,它由 JSON 文本组成,该文本由逗号分隔的属性组成。JSON 对象是一个包含 JSON 对象的 JSON 对象,可以使用 JSON.parse() 方法将其转换为 JavaScript 对象。 在使用 JSON 对象时,可能会遇到需要访问对象中的内部...
java将实体类转为json_JavaWeb实体类转为json对象的实现方法
java将实体类转为json_JavaWeb实体类转为json对象的实现⽅法1.创建个实体类实体类User代码:ity;import lombok.AllArgsConstructor;import lombok.Data;import lombok.NoArgsConstructor;import java.util.Date;/*** Keafmd*...
java如何追加写入txt文件
java如何追加写⼊txt⽂件java中,对⽂件进⾏追加内容操作的三种⽅法1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16import java.io.BufferedWriter;import java.io.FileOutputStream;import java.io.FileWriter;import java.io.IOException;import jav...
【IT专家】php如何判断用户通过手机wap访问还是电脑直接访问
手机unknown是什么意思本文由我司收集整编,推荐下载,如有疑问,请与我司联系php如何判断用户通过手机wap访问还是电脑直接访问2009/05/15 3206 最近做一个手机查询系统,自然就牵扯到了此问题,那我就根据对wap的认识浅谈下通过php判断用户访问方式是通过wap访问还是电脑直接访问。首先说最根本的解决方法:手机访问时,会附带发送user-agent信息,这个信息里面会有手机号码信息...
基于SOA的企业应用跨安全域访问控制
基于SOA的企业应用跨安全域访问控制 基于SOA的企业应用跨安全域访问控制 随着信息技术的发展,越来越多的企业开始将关注点转向了利用现有的IT资产和资源来提高业务流程的效率和灵活性。面对企业应用跨安全域访问的需求,基于服务导向架构(Service-Oriented Architecture,简称SOA)的解决方案成为了一种可行的选择。本文将探讨基...
Linux自测试题三套(带答案)
Linux自测题试卷1选择题,单选或多选(每题2分,共20题,合计40分)1、小张是某公司的计算机管理员,他需要为公司的一台运行Red Hat Linux 9的计算机配置网络连接,并将DNS服务器指向当地电信运营商提供的DNS服务器。小张可以通过修改( )文件来完成上述有关DNS服务器的配置。(选择一项)a)/etc/hostsb)/fc)/f...
学习随笔一SOAAOS面向对象与面向数据
学习随笔⼀SOAAOS⾯向对象与⾯向数据SOA 数组的结构与AOS结构的数组,是⾯向数据和⾯向对象设计的区别之⼀。在需要⾼频率(如渲染循环中)访问数据的时候,⼀般情况下SOA的效率⾼于AOS,因为将需要频繁访问的数据连续存放会⼤⼤提⾼访问速度。虽然AOS的结构可能更适合⾯向对象设计,但是在⾼度依赖效率的地⽅应该使⽤SOA。引⽤⼤家都在说的⼀句话:⼀开始写程序⽤struct (c⽅式的编程,⾯向数据...
php状态命令,实时查看及监控PHP-FPM的运行状态
php状态命令,实时查看及监控PHP-FPM的运⾏状态PHP-FPM内置了状态页,开启后可查看PHP-FPM的详细运⾏状态,给PHP-FPM优化带来帮助。下⾯本篇⽂章就来记录⼀下如何实时的查看及监控php-fpm的运⾏状态。打开f,配置php-fpm状态页选项pm.status_path = /phpfpm_status(默认值为:status)配置f,添加...
护卫神设置public目录(IIS下TP5如何设置运行目录)
护卫神设置public⽬录(IIS下TP5如何设置运⾏⽬录)护卫神设置public⽬录最近有⼈问⼩编,护卫神主机系统或者IIS配置PHP的时候,public设置为对外公开⽬录这个问题百度⽆法搜索到真实解决办法,那么我们应该如何将运⾏⽬录设置为/public呢?当我们使⽤护卫神主机系统配置Thinkphp的时候,发现Thinkphp的运⾏⽬录public在护卫神⾥⽆法设置为运⾏⽬录,护卫神创建的⽹站...
php判断pc代码,判断用户是PC还是移动端的php代码
php判断pc代码,判断⽤户是PC还是移动端的php代码本⽂我们来分享⽤php如何识别⽤户是通过 PC、iPad 还是⼿机,然后我们还可以看看腾讯的通过JS语句判断WEB⽹站的访问端是电脑还是⼿机。先我们来看看⼀段⽤php如何识别⽤户是通过 PC、iPad 还是⼿机来访问⽹站?以下是腾讯的通过JS语句判断WEB⽹站的访问端是电脑还是⼿机腾讯⽹的适配代码如何判断访问⽹站的机器类型-如何判断ipadJ...
PHP-thinkPHP快速入门
PHP-thinkPHP快速⼊门1.教程⼤纲这是⼀篇零基础的thinkPHP教程,全篇看完只需要要⼀个⼩时,通过⼀个简单的⽹站,我会由点到⾯的讲述a.基础的讲述thinkPHP的路由、请求、响应、模板的渲染。b.如何在thinkPHP框架下实现MVC的设计模式,三层架构之间的跳转和引⽤。c.如何通过原⽣的SQL语句或者是通过继承model类封装的⽅法实现对于数据库的增删改查。2.⽹站demoa.登...
phpunit远程代码执行漏洞(CVE-2017-9841)
phpunit远程代码执⾏漏洞(CVE-2017-9841)声明好好学习,天天向上漏洞描述composer是php包管理⼯具,使⽤composer安装扩展包将会在当前⽬录创建⼀个vendor⽂件夹,并将所有⽂件放在其中。通常这个⽬录需要放在web⽬录外,使⽤户不能直接访问。phpunit是php中的单元测试⼯具,其4.8.19 ~ 4.8.27和5.0.10 ~ 5.6.2版本的vendor/ph...
matlab类数组的使用
matlab类数组的使用关于Matlab类数组的使用在使用Matlab编程语言过程中,经常会遇到类数组的概念和使用。类数组是指由相同类型的元素构成的数据结构,每个元素可以通过索引访问。本篇文章将介绍Matlab中类数组的基本知识、创建类数组的几种方法、类数组的访问和操作、以及一些常用的类数组函数。一、类数组的基本知识类数组在Matlab中是非常重要的数据结构之一,它可以存储和处理大量数据,为程序的...
《Web数据库设计与开发》练习题
《Web 数据库设计与开发》练习题第一章 概述一、单项选择题1 、World Wide Web 诞生于( )。A 、1989 年 B 、1990 年 C 、1991 年 D 、1992 年答案: B2 、Web 服务器主要使用的协议是( )。A 、HTTP B 、FTP  ...
Java语言程序设计试卷D卷
武汉商业服务学院2007-2008学年第二学期期末考试《 &...
C语言中的指针和数组的关系与区别
C语言中的指针和数组的关系与区别导言:C语言是一种常用的编程语言,拥有强大的指针和数组功能。指针和数组在C语言中是非常重要的概念,本文将探讨指针和数组的关系和区别,帮助读者更好地理解和应用这两个概念。一、指针和数组的基本概念指针是一个变量,存储的是一个内存地址。通过指针可以直接访问内存中的数据。在C语言中,可以使用指针变量存储数组元素的地址,从而实现对数组的访问。数组是由相同类型的元素组成的数据结...
vector和list的区别是什么
vector和list的区别是什么对于学c语言的同学来说,vector和list这两个东西经常会搞错。下面是店铺为大家准备的vector和list的区别是什么,希望大家喜欢!vector和list的区别一:vector是顺序表,表示的是一块连续的内存,元素被顺序存储;list是双向连接表,在内存中不一定连续。vector和list的区别二:当数值内存不够时,vector会重新申请一块足够大的连续内...
c语言枚举和结构体的区别
c语言枚举和结构体的区别 C语言中,枚举(enum)和结构体(struct)是两种不同的数据类型,它们之间有以下区别: 1. 枚举是一种常量集合,常用于定义一组相关的常量,例如星期几、月份等,它们都是由一些特定的常量值组成。枚举常量的值默认从0开始依次递增,可以手动指定枚举值或者改变默认枚举值的起始值。 2. 结构体是一...
c语言中volatile关键字是什么含义
c语言中volatile关键字是什么含义 最佳答案 volatile 影响编译器编译的结果,指出,volatile 变量是随时可能发生变化的,与volatile变量有关的运算,不要进行编译优化,以免出错,(VC++ 在产生release版可执行码时会进行编译优化,加volatile关键字的变量有关的运算,将不进行编译优化。)。例如:volatile int i=10;int j = i;...i...
c语言结构体点和箭头的区别
c语言结构体点和箭头的区别摘要:1.结构体简介2.点表示法与箭头表示法的概念区分c语言和c++区别3.点表示法的应用场景4.箭头表示法的优势与适用场景5.总结与建议正文:在很多编程语言中,结构体(struct)是一种重要的数据类型,用于将不同类型的数据组合在一起。在C语言中,结构体也有着广泛的应用。在谈论结构体时,不得不提及两点表示法和箭头表示法。它们在表示结构体变量时有着明显的区别,下面就让我们...
c语言中结构体和结构体指针的区别
c语言中结构体和结构体指针的区别摘要:1.结构体与结构体指针的概念与定义c语言和c++区别2.结构体指针的使用方法与注意事项3.结构体指针与结构体变量作形参的区别4.结构体指针在实际编程中的应用场景正文:C语言中,结构体和结构体指针是编程中常见的数据类型和操作方式。许多初学者对它们之间的区别和使用方法存在疑惑。本文将详细解析结构体与结构体指针的区别,以及结构体指针的使用方法和实际应用场景。首先,我...
c语言中箭头和点的区别
c语言中箭头和点的区别 C语言中,箭头和点都是用来访问结构体中的成员变量的符号,但它们有着不同的使用场景和意义。 点号(.)用于访问结构体变量中的成员变量,例如: struct Student { char name[20]; int age; ...
jsp的复习题
选择题1 、Page 指令用于定义 JSP 文件中的全局属性, 下列关于该指令用法的描述不正确的是:( ) (A)<%@ page %>作用于整个 JSP 页面。(B)可以在一个页面中使用多个<%@ page %>指令。(C)为增强程序的可读性,建议将<%@ page %>指令放在 JSP 文件的开头,但不是必须的。(D)&...
JSP的优势
JSP的优势以下列出了使⽤JSP带来的其他好处:与ASP相⽐:JSP有两⼤优势。⾸先,动态部分⽤Java编写,⽽不是VB或其他MS专⽤语⾔,所以更加强⼤与易⽤。第⼆点就是JSP 易于移植到⾮MS平台上。与纯 Servlet 相⽐:JSP可以很⽅便的编写或者修改HTML⽹页⽽不⽤去⾯对⼤量的println语句。与SSI相⽐:SSI⽆法使⽤表单数据、⽆法进⾏数据库链接。与JavaScript相⽐:虽然...
web静态和动态的区别
web静态和动态的区别⼀、静态web页⾯:1、在静态Web程序中,客户端使⽤Web浏览器(IE、FireFox等)经过⽹络(Network)连接到服务器上,使⽤HTTP协议发起⼀个请求(Request),告诉服务器我现在需要得到哪个页⾯,所有的请求交给Web服务器,之后WEB服务器根据⽤户的需要,从⽂件系统(存放了所有静态页⾯的磁盘)取出内容。之后通过Web服务器返回给客户端,客户端接收到内容之后...
java期末考试知识点总结
java 学问点总结应同学要求,特意写了一个学问点总结,因比较匆忙,可能归纳不是很准确,重点是面对对象的局部。java 有三个版本:JAVA SE 标准版\JAVA ME 移动版\JAVA EE 企业版java 常用命令:java, javac, appletviewj...
Python中优雅处理JSON文件的方法实例
Python中优雅处理JSON⽂件的⽅法实例⽬录1. 引⾔2. 什么是JSON⽂件?3. 使⽤Python处理JSON⽂件3.1. 将JSON⽂件读取为字典类型3.2. 将JSON⽂件读取为Pandas类型3.3. 使⽤Pandas读取嵌套JSON类型3.4. 访问特定位置的数据3.5. 导出JSON3.6. 格式化输出3.7. 输出字段排序4.总结5.参考1. 引⾔在本⽂中,我们将学习如何使⽤P...
js操作json的基本方法
js操作json的基本⽅法 js操作json时,常⽤的是使⽤[]或者.来获取json属性的值。使⽤上还是有些区别的。 JSON(JavaScript Object Notation) 是⼀种轻量级的数据交换格式。易于⼈阅读和编写。同时也易于机器解析和⽣成。它基于JavaScript(Standard ECMA-262 3rd Edition - December 1999)...